Do not separate the tubers and roots from the clump. \u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003ePlant spacing\u003c\/strong\u003e: 15-40cm apart\u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eWatering\u003c\/strong\u003e: Every 3-4 days when planted in the ground for 10 minutes\u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e\u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e\u003cb data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003ePosition and soil\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eDahlia requires a well-draining soil, if your gardens soil has too much clay then add some sand and compost to improve its quality. You can apply mulch to the top of the soil to keep the moisture in. The plant prefers heat and enjoys being in the full sun. They can endure shade during midday which will decrease their need for water. \u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eWhen planting, ensure the tubers are pointed down. \u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e\u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eFurther Care\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eThe plant will do well with a regular feeding of \u003cstrong data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e\u003cu data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eHadeco Bulb Food\u003c\/u\u003e\u003c\/strong\u003e.\u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eYou might need to provide some of the taller varieties with a stake if they look like they are going to fall over. We recommend that you prune the plants back every now and again as this will promote further growth. You can maximize the size of the flower by reducing the size of the two buds next to it – allowing the central one to grow alone.\u003cbr data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003eIf you notice deformed\/stunted growth or mottled foliage, the plant has been infected and should be discarded as soon as possible. As the season ends, the leaves of the plant may turn yellow, you can cut and break these leaves away.\u003cspan data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e \u003c\/span\u003e\u003cem data-mce-fragment=\"1\"\u003e \u003c\/em\u003eIf you would like to lift them, do it in July. Cut the stem roughly 5cm above the ground. You can then lift the tuberous root. If they were well fed, there should be an increase in the size and quantity of tubers around the crown.
